Capturing the life of Little India: ARTWALK 2019

ARTWALK Little India is a multi-disciplinary public art festival organised annually by the LASALLE College of the Arts and Singapore Tourism Board. This year, the theme is ‘Image and Sound of Fragrance’, celebrating the way scents evoke our emotions and memories.
